The invention provides a method and device for installing the operating system, the method comprises: a request message is sent to the network device is connected with the equipment; the received response message is returned to the network device, the response message carries with the BIOS mode, the boot file name to guide the installation file to install the server; sends the guide file name to download request, the boot file and receives the installation server and the boot file corresponding to the name; using the boot file in the equipment installation of the operating system, and the BIOS mode. Through the application of the technical scheme, through the deployment of an installation server, you can complete all the equipment to be installed operating system installation process, save the installation server resources. It can meet the requirement of parallel batch installation in many operating systems, thus speeding up the installation process of operating system.
【技术实现步骤摘要】
一种操作系统的安装方法和装置
本申请涉及通信
,尤其涉及一种操作系统的安装方法和装置。
技术介绍
随着云计算互联网产业的爆发式发展,服务器数量不断增长,由于服务器的应用需求不同,因此,服务器对于操作系统的安装需求也变得多样化。具体的,不同服务器可能运行在不同BIOS(BasicInputOutputSystem,基本输入输出系统)模式下,如UEFI(UniformedExtensibleFirmwareInterface,统一可扩展固件接口,即新式BIOS模式)或者Legacy(遗留,即传统BIOS模式)等。目前,为了安装不同BIOS模式的操作系统,需部署多个PXE(prebootexecuteenvironment,预启动执行环境)服务器,每个PXE服务器负责一种BIOS模式。例如,PXE服务器1用于为接入自身的所有待安装设备(即待安装操作系统的服务器,其又可以称为UUT)安装UEFI模式的操作系统,PXE服务器2用于为接入自身的所有待安装设备安装Legacy模式的操作系统。但是,在上述方式下,需要部署多个PXE服务器,BIOS模式越多,则需要的PXE服务 ...
【技术保护点】
一种操作系统的安装方法,应用于待安装设备,其特征在于,包括:向与本设备连接的网络设备发送请求消息;接收所述网络设备返回的响应消息,所述响应消息携带与所述待安装设备的基本输入输出系统BIOS模式匹配的引导文件名称;向安装服务器发送携带所述引导文件名称的引导文件下载请求,并接收所述安装服务器返回的与所述引导文件名称对应的引导文件;利用所述引导文件在本设备安装与所述BIOS模式匹配的操作系统。
【技术特征摘要】
1.一种操作系统的安装方法,应用于待安装设备,其特征在于,包括:向与本设备连接的网络设备发送请求消息;接收所述网络设备返回的响应消息,所述响应消息携带与所述待安装设备的基本输入输出系统BIOS模式匹配的引导文件名称;向安装服务器发送携带所述引导文件名称的引导文件下载请求,并接收所述安装服务器返回的与所述引导文件名称对应的引导文件;利用所述引导文件在本设备安装与所述BIOS模式匹配的操作系统。2.根据权利要求1所述的方法,其特征在于,所述利用所述引导文件在本设备安装与所述BIOS模式匹配的操作系统的过程,具体包括:从所述引导文件中解析出策略信息,所述策略信息包括第一地址类型和第二地址类型的优先级关系,其中,第一地址类型的优先级优于第二地址类型的优先级;向安装服务器发送携带与所述第一地址类型对应的第一地址信息的配置文件下载请求;若接收到安装服务器返回的与所述第一地址信息对应的第一类型配置文件,则利用所述第一类型配置文件安装与所述BIOS模式匹配的操作系统;若未接收到第一类型配置文件,则向安装服务器发送携带与所述第二地址类型对应的第二地址信息的配置文件下载请求,并接收安装服务器返回的与所述第二地址信息对应的第二类型配置文件,并利用第二类型配置文件进行独立磁盘冗余阵列RAID配置。3.根据权利要求2所述的方法,其特征在于,所述利用第二类型配置文件进行RAID配置的过程,具体包括:从第二类型配置文件中解析出内存系统文件名称,向安装服务器发送携带内存系统文件名称的内存系统文件下载请求;接收安装服务器返回的与所述内存系统文件名称对应的内存系统文件,利用所述内存系统文件进行RAID配置;将所述待安装设备的第一地址信息发送给所述安装服务器,以使所述安装服务器生成所述第一地址信息对应的第一类型配置文件。4.一种操作系统的安装方法,应用于安装服务器,其特征在于,包括:接收来自待安装设备的引导文件下载请求,所述引导文件下载请求携带引导文件名称,所述引导文件名称是所述待安装设备从网络设备获取的与所述待安装设备的基本输入输出系统BIOS模式匹配的引导文件名称;查询到与所述引导文件名称对应的引导文件,并将所述引导文件返回给所述待安装设备,以使所述待安装设备利用所述引导文件安装操作系统。5.根据权利要求4所述的方法,其特征在于,所述方法进一步包括:在接收到来自待安装设备的携带第一地址信息的配置文件下载请求时,查询本地是否存在所述第一地址信息对应的第一类型配置文件;如果是,则将所述第一地址信息对应的第一类型配置文件返回给所述待安装设备,以使所述待安装设备利用所述第一类型配置文件安装操作系统;如果否,则停止处理,并在接收到来自所述待安装设备的携带第二地址信息的配置文件下载请求时,将所述第二地址信息对应的第二类型配置文件返回给所述待安装设备,以使所述待安装设备利用所述第二类型配置文件进行独立磁盘冗余阵列RAID配置。6.根据权利要求5所述的方法,其特征在于,在所述待安装设备利用所述第二类型配置文件进行RAID配置的过程中,所述方法进一步包括:接收所述待安装设备发送的携带内存系统文件名称的内存系统文件下载请求,所述内存系统文件名称是所述待安装设备从所述第二类型配置文件中解析的;将所述内存系统文件名称对应的内存系统文件返回给所述待安装设备,以使所述待安装设备利用所述内存系统文件进行RAID配置;确定与所述待安装设备的BIOS模式、操作系统类型匹配的模板文件,并利用所述模板文件与第一地址信息,生成第一地址信息对应的第一类型配置文件。7.一种操作系统的安装装置,应用于待安装设备,其特征在于,包括:发送模块,用于向与所述待安装设备连接的网络设备发送请求消息;接收模块,用于接收所述网络设备返回的响应消息,所述响应消息携带与所述待安装设备的基本...
【专利技术属性】
技术研发人员:强小军,沈刚,廖小荣,
申请(专利权)人:紫光华山信息技术有限公司,
类型:发明
国别省市:浙江,33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。